Artist Statement:
I like the sensuality and depth of colour in oil paint. Painting with a palette knife dictates I loosen up and trust in chance; my aim is to assert the materiality of the oil paint on the painting surface.
I allow the paint to be itself before it is a description of anything, this establishes it's language and meaning. The painting becomes an entity in its own right, image and paint essential equals demanding I work a certain direction and in a way dictating where I shall take it to next.
Indifferent natural forces, colossal energy, sweeping light and storms shape limestoned Wales and Cornwall's ancient granite coastline where I "practice my craft and sullen art"*
Allan Storer. *Dylan Thomas...

Allan Storer's love is the environment of Cornwall's old fishing town, St.Ives and the Gower Peninsular in South Wales; having lived a lot of his life in both places.
Using a palette knife along with thick lashings of oil paint,the artist's objective is to achieve vibrant energy in his paintings.
Paintings are exhibited with local Galleries in London, Cornwall and Wales. |
